#550294 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#550294 is composed of 33.3% red, 0.8% green and 58%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 42.6% cyan, 98.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 42% black. It has a hue angle of 274.1 degrees, a saturation of 97.3% and a lightness of 29.4%. #550294 color hex could be obtained by blending #aa04ff with #000029. Closest websafe color is: #660099.

Shades and Tints of #550294

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#07000d is the darkest color, while #fcf8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#550294

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4c474f is the less saturated color, while #550294 is the most saturated one.
